Quantifying Cyber Risk: Challenges and Implications
Leading cybersecurity professionals and insurance specialists voice concerns over the challenges associated with quantifying cyber risk. This quantification is essential, as it impacts insurance premiums, claims processing, and overall risk management strategies. Even as advancements in technology provide more tools for risk assessment, the evolving nature of cyber threats continues to pose significant challenges, affecting how accurately these risks can be predicted and managed within the insurance ecosystem.
Long-Term Impact on Insurance Underwriting
Incorporating cyber risk assessments in insurance underwriting promises to reshape the industry’s approach to risk management. According to experts, this integration not only enhances the precision of risk measurement but also aligns insurance strategies more closely with real-time cyber threat landscapes. As insurers become more adept at interpreting complex cyber risk indicators, the practice is anticipated to bring about substantial improvements in underwriting procedures, resulting in personalized policies that reflect the specific threat profile of each client.
